This brilliantly witty play captures the reality of three legendary actors being trapped on the ‘Orca,’ egos clashing, waiting for a mechanical shark that refuses to work to attack. It's Hollywood chaos at its finest. The show fits perfectly into our season exploring 'truth and illusion' because it reveals the messy, hilarious reality behind movie magic - Robert Shaw’s journals captured their day-to-day reality and while those days did not make it to the screen it embodied a story that was just as compelling as the film itself.
